We are currently looking to add two (2)  Quality Control Laboratory Analyst's to our team in St. Cloud, MN.   In this role, you will be responsible for performing core quality control testing and packaging event evaluations on Microbiologics products. All work must be conducted in accordance with applicable product specifications, policies, and procedures, with the goal of ensuring that only products meeting all Microbiologics acceptance criteria are approved for release.

 

What can I expect in this role?

In this position, you will work 7 am – 4:30 pm Monday thru Thursday, and 7:00 am – 11:00 am on Friday.  

 

 Some key duties in this role include:

·        Perform quality control testing on Microbiologics’ products in accordance with appropriate specifications. Products include microorganisms and molecular items. Ensure identification and traceability of material.

·        Performs automated and manual testing. Troubleshoots when necessary. Reports problems to their supervisor.

·        Performs quality checks to ensure proper functioning of instruments, reagents and procedures.

·        Operates testing equipment such as identification instrumentation, enumeration equipment, balance, applying logic and various analytical methods to determine results

·        Recognize when results are out of specification and make appropriate notifications in accordance with procedures.

·        Tests accurately and documents results in a timely manner according to company policies and procedures.

·        Maintains familiarity with Microbiologics’ product inserts, and current Clinical and Laboratory Standards Institute (CLSI) and government regulations.

·        Responsible for maintenance of documentation as it applies to a responsible and responsive Quality System regarding the provisions of quality assurance and laboratory service.

·        Competency in core responsibilities per the quality control training metrics.

Education and/or experience required:

  • Four-year microbiology or related degree or equivalent work experience required.
  • Practical biology laboratory experience preferred.
  • The ability to pass a background check and drug screening.

  

Who is Microbiologics?

Microbiologics is one of the fastest growing international biotechnology companies in the nation. We are the world’s leading experts and go-to collaborators in biological products and services, focused on protecting the health and safety of people around the world. For over 50 years, we have been partnering with healthcare and life science laboratories, manufacturers, and suppliers across the globe to co-create and provide biological control materials, assay services and consulting for microbiology, molecular diagnostics, and virology. Headquartered in Saint Cloud, Minnesota, we have additional facilities in California, Kentucky, and Michigan.
